Musicfy is usually evaluated as an AI voice, song, and music creation tool for vocal-led generation and creator experiments. It can be a good fit when the team primarily needs voice-driven music ideas, AI covers, vocal workflows, and song experiments.
Sonilo is the clearer fit when the input is a finished or near-finished video and the output needs to follow timing, pacing, scene changes, voice-over space, and commercial release requirements.

Most musicfy alternative searches are really workflow searches: the buyer wants to know which tool fits video publishing, API integration, commercial licensing, and repeatable production.
Use Musicfy when the creative job is centered on voices, vocals, covers, or song ideas. Use Sonilo when the project needs video-scored background music, sound effects, licensing review, and API-ready generation for published video.
Video teams comparing Musicfy with Sonilo usually need a different output: an instrumental or sound-design layer that supports the edit instead of a vocal-led song asset.
